## Getting started: the user module split

Welcome! Quick context: we're carving the user module out of the old Greymarsh monolith into its own service, Userforge. For plugin authors, the big change is that profile reads now go through the Userforge API instead of the monolith's shared database — yes, really, no more direct table access. The sandbox environment mirrors production schemas and resets nightly, so feel free to break things. To start making calls against the sandbox, use the plugin-development key provided just below.

gateway credential: kto23_LX9A4ys6i4nzHtpOLNLodKK

# Build Provenance: Quillhaven Circuit Breaker

The circuit breaker guarding the upstream Lanternwell API was introduced to stop cascading timeouts during their maintenance windows. It trips after five consecutive failures and half-opens after thirty seconds. Provenance matters here: every deploy of the breaker config is stamped so we can correlate trip events with the exact build that shipped them. For this week's sync, note the breaker tripped twice under the current release. That release is identified below.

build token for kagaf-hahof: htk14_9d3d4d26d7d8de

**Q: How are cold storage buckets archived in Frostvault?**

Archival runs nightly. Buckets idle for 180 days move to the Glacierline tier with object-lock enabled. Access requires dual approval from the Keeper group; no single operator can restore alone. Encryption keys rotate quarterly and old keys are escrowed offline in the Tallow Ridge facility. Audit events stream to the immutable log and cannot be suppressed. If the escrow HSM is unreachable, restores fall back to the sealed recovery envelope. The passphrase for that envelope is:

vault phrase of hahop-badug = novvan-ulaion-zorius-noviel-gorwyn-casix-tamys